Abstract

In this study, we report a systematical study by changing Ts on growth of Co3FeN thin films on LSAT substrate and its magnetic properties including AMR ratio. As a result, we obtain larger absolute value of the AMR ratio than our previous report. In addition, we succeeded in measuring the spin polarization of Co3FeN by point contact Andreev reflection. Finally, we would like to discuss the relationship between AMR ratio and spin polarization.
